I am on Day 8 with my Welsummer and EE eggs. I candled them tonight and I weighed them. Their weight is right on track with a 5% weight loss, but most of their air cells seem large, not like the pictures under the sticky for this forum, they seem more like they would be day 12 or so. Also, they aren't as round and even as the picture. I know two of my eggs have a detached air cell that I have been trying to rehabilitate by keeping them upright. So are the air cells seeming large an indication that I need my humidity higher even though they are on target with weight loss? What do the not round air cells mean? If these are shipped eggs they could have lost some moisture during shipping depending on the conditions. You don't say what your humidity is but I would bump it a bit. If the air cell is too big the chick doesn't have enough room to grow.
